What is EoV technology ?What is EoV technology ?
Ethernet over VDSL enables the extension of Ethernet over telephone lines to a distances of 1200m using VDSL transport.
10Mbps (Full Duplex) + Telephone on one line
How does EoV work?How does EoV work?
• Ethernet over VDSL transmits 10Mbps data over frequencies unused by the telephone service.

What is Cross Talk?What is Cross Talk?
• Transmission from one pair interfere with transmission from other lines
• The more DSL lines on the same bundle, the more the chance
For interference

More about ADSL vs. EoVMore about ADSL vs. EoV
• Uses ATM as the Layer 2
– High cost of operation
– Limited and expensive scalability
– Complex installation, management and configuration
• Limited for business deployment
– Not scalable for speed
– Not symmetric (By definition…)
– ADSL for long distance, EoV for up to 1200m

MDU and MTU ApplicationMDU and MTU Application
• Simultaneous Voice and Data support - speak while you surf
• Utilizes existing telephone infrastructure – no rewiring needed
• Fast Internet access
• New office services can be offered to customers:
– Printing, fax gateway, and voice over IP gateway
LAN Extension in Campus EnvironmentLAN Extension in Campus Environment
• Large Campus areas can use existing cupper lines for Ethernet connectivity
• Cheaper than digging up fiber
• Ideal for:
– Universities
– Community Neighborhoods
– Hospitals
